ALEPPO–Syria–The Prelacy of Aleppo announced this week–that week-long activities between April 20 to 27 will highlight a pilgrimage–on April 24–to Der-Zor to mark the 85th anniversary of the Armenian Genocide. His Holiness Aram I–Catholicos of the Holy See of Cilcia preside over the ceremonies and lead the pilgrimage.
The pilgrimage is organized by the Aleppo Prelacy and the Armenia-based committee set up to mark the 1700th anniversary of Armenia’s adoption of Christianity as a state religion.
Archbishop Souren Kataroian–Prelate of Aleppo has convened a special committee to oversee activities in Der-Zor and plan the scheduled pilgrimage.
The Prelacy called on Armenia’s from around the world to take part in this important pilgrimage.
In Der Zor an Armenian Church is constructed where remains of the more than 300,000 Armenia’s victims of the Genocide are stored.
